Improve: Reduce master program redundant code

This commit is contained in:
yuanyuanxiang
2025-06-28 23:52:26 +08:00
parent 44f28defa2
commit c59232d179
39 changed files with 361 additions and 872 deletions

View File

@@ -38,7 +38,7 @@ extern "C"
// CScreenSpyDlg <20>Ի<EFBFBD><D4BB><EFBFBD>
class CScreenSpyDlg : public CDialog
class CScreenSpyDlg : public DialogBase
{
DECLARE_DYNAMIC(CScreenSpyDlg)
@@ -46,9 +46,6 @@ public:
CScreenSpyDlg(CWnd* Parent, IOCPServer* IOCPServer=NULL, CONTEXT_OBJECT *ContextObject=NULL);
virtual ~CScreenSpyDlg();
CONTEXT_OBJECT* m_ContextObject;
IOCPServer* m_iocpServer;
VOID SendNext(void);
VOID OnReceiveComplete();
HDC m_hFullDC;
@@ -63,11 +60,9 @@ public:
ULONG m_ulVScrollPos;
VOID DrawTipString(CString strString);
HICON m_hIcon;
HICON m_hCursor;
POINT m_ClientCursorPos;
BYTE m_bCursorIndex;
CString m_strClientIP;
BOOL m_bIsTraceCursor;
CCursorInfo m_CursorInfo; //<2F>Զ<EFBFBD><D4B6><EFBFBD><EFBFBD><EFBFBD>һ<EFBFBD><D2BB>ϵͳ<CFB5>Ĺ<EFBFBD><C4B9><EFBFBD><EFBFBD><EFBFBD>
VOID SendCommand(const MSG64* Msg);